Jump to content

Устройства на контроллере Ф3


Recommended Posts

Posted

Ну круть, нет слов!

Комп: MSI GTX 1080ti GAMING X, MSI Z370 GAMING M5, Intel Core i7-8700K Coffee Lake, Kingston DDR4 32Gb, SSD M2 Samsung 970PRO, Gunfighter Pro MCG Pro, BRD-F2 Restyling, Trackir5 + clip pro:smilewink:

Posted

Обновил файлы для эскизирования, теперь таблица учитывает уже приобретенные модули, в ней нужно заполнить количество тумблеров, кнопок, ... чтобы не выйти за максимальные ограничения, которые автоматически выделяются красным.

После чего можно компоновать элемены в "конструкторе".

 

если что не получается, обращайтесь, но там все просто, делается в обычном Excelе и Wordе

 

Присылайте свои варианты, панелей.

Вот, вероятно, эскиз будущего модуля

blob2.PNG.06d7edb8cf0cfca510625ad5226ef298.PNG

Posted
Пробовал разные комбинации с настройками тумблеров.

В конфигураторе контроллера их можно настроить:

1) как тумблер (когда в одном положении он постоянно включен, а в другом выключен

2) как кнопка (когда при переключении происходит импульс, не важно в какое положение

3) как 2 кнопки ( в одном положении импульс кнопки №1, в другом импульс №2)

С 3-х позиционными тумблерами кроме этих 3х настроек и их комбинаций возможен еще вариант:

4) 3 отдельных кнопки, для этого надо использовать эмулируемую кнопку с условием - не нажата ни 1-я ни 2-я

 

А можно энкодер настроить по логике работы галетного переключателя на 5 позиций?

Повернул один раз энкодер сработала 1 кнопка, повернул 2 раз сработала 2 и т.д. Было бы вообще ВАУ!

Intel Celeron - 333/2 планки DIMM по 128 мб/ATI 3D PCI 4 Mb/640х480/HDD 4ГБ/клавиатура+мышь/DSC World 2.5/ни чё не фризит/не тормозит/багов нет/картинки тоже нет :joystick:

Posted (edited)

У энкодера есть функции многоскоростного энкодера, - поворачиваешь медленно одна кнопка поворачиваешь быстрее 2-я еще быстрее 3-я.

 

А зачем энкодером галетник имитировать? хотя можно...

можно на импульс энкодера прикрутить емулируемую кнопку с циклическим переключением на несколько виртуальных кнопок

 

получится крутишь в право нажимается

1r 2r 3r 4r 5r. 1r 2r 3r 4r 5r....

влево нажимается

1L 2L 3L 4L 5L 1L 2L 3L 4L 5L...

 

 

но где это можно применить в симуляторе? 10 разных кнопок на одной крутилке?

тем более у энкодера нет таких четких щелчков, как у галетника, нужное место трудно будет поймать.

 

обычный энкодер дает импульсы на 1у правую и 1у левую кнопку.

на видео выше, так яркость илса регулируется

Edited by Alextus
Posted (edited)

Да, уж это точно. Уже 2,5 месяца владею платой F3 а конфигуратор только сегодня начал осваивать. Класс! На счет использования энкодера как галетник спасибо. Буду тестить. Я его хочу повесить как крутилку включения разных режимов системы противодествия на панели CMSP в A-10C, там как раз 4 кнопки получается вправо и 4 обратно, влево.

Edited by Andreilo

Intel Celeron - 333/2 планки DIMM по 128 мб/ATI 3D PCI 4 Mb/640х480/HDD 4ГБ/клавиатура+мышь/DSC World 2.5/ни чё не фризит/не тормозит/багов нет/картинки тоже нет :joystick:

Posted

Кстати экспорт на контроллер можно с Helios-ом одновременно использовать, там в readme инструкция есть простенькая

Posted

Да, я читал ее. Но для меня вполне хватает возможностей самого контролера и настроек в игре. Кокпит у меня простенький.

Intel Celeron - 333/2 планки DIMM по 128 мб/ATI 3D PCI 4 Mb/640х480/HDD 4ГБ/клавиатура+мышь/DSC World 2.5/ни чё не фризит/не тормозит/багов нет/картинки тоже нет :joystick:

Posted

Возник наболевший вопрос. Почему жестко тормозит интерфейс контролера и долгий его запуск. На обучающих виде все как-то живенько работает.

Intel Celeron - 333/2 планки DIMM по 128 мб/ATI 3D PCI 4 Mb/640х480/HDD 4ГБ/клавиатура+мышь/DSC World 2.5/ни чё не фризит/не тормозит/багов нет/картинки тоже нет :joystick:

Posted

Это уже вопрос к техподдержке, т.е. ко мне))

В конфигураторе сверху есть меню "Управление конфигурацией", там можно сделать сохранение полной конфигурации в файл. Отправьте мне его (можно на скайп kreml75, либо тут на форуме к сообщению прикрепите)

НЕТ ВОБЛЕ!

Posted

Вот. Пришлось переименовать расширение, так как XML не разрешен для загрузки

L3.txt

Intel Celeron - 333/2 планки DIMM по 128 мб/ATI 3D PCI 4 Mb/640х480/HDD 4ГБ/клавиатура+мышь/DSC World 2.5/ни чё не фризит/не тормозит/багов нет/картинки тоже нет :joystick:

Posted (edited)

Варианты взаимодействия устройств, контроллера и симулятора

1795190864_.thumb.jpg.cbd2e37d731aa7e5d2b520f9b344891e.jpg

 

Ввод и вЫвод

 

Первый способ подходит вообще для любых игр с джойстиками. тут работает только ввод (кнопки, оси, тумблеры, галетники, энкодеры) настройки управления осуществляются непосредственно в игре.

 

второй способ для игр способных экспортировать/импортировать данные (DCS, MFS, X-Plane)

 

третий способ комбинированный, ввод осуществляется через вирт. джойстик, а вывод через экспорт, сервер, роутер, он подходит когда есть экспортные данные а импорта нет, (например для ГС3 экспорт индикаторов есть, а кнопки пока не сделали, в процессе)

Edited by Alextus
  • 2 weeks later...
Posted

Можно в схему взаимодействия еще одно звено добавить, когда функции ввода обрабатываются роутером и сразу возвращаются в контроллер на вывод индикации. Такой режим нужен для симуляции некоторых функций которые отсутствуют в стандартном списке экспорта.

НЕТ ВОБЛЕ!

Posted (edited)

Коллекция приборов в составе проекта постепенно пополняется.

Совместная работа приборов:

Edited by kreml

НЕТ ВОБЛЕ!

Posted

:thumbup:

Блин до своих не как не доберусь панелей

Комп: MSI GTX 1080ti GAMING X, MSI Z370 GAMING M5, Intel Core i7-8700K Coffee Lake, Kingston DDR4 32Gb, SSD M2 Samsung 970PRO, Gunfighter Pro MCG Pro, BRD-F2 Restyling, Trackir5 + clip pro:smilewink:

Posted

надо будет для удобства подключения делать на корпусе еще одну отдельную розетку питания, чтобы последовательно подключать устройства и не делать разветвление проводов на блоке питания.

Posted
Можно в схему взаимодействия еще одно звено добавить, когда функции ввода обрабатываются роутером и сразу возвращаются в контроллер на вывод индикации. Такой режим нужен для симуляции некоторых функций которые отсутствуют в стандартном списке экспорта.

 

Точно!

Так сделана, например, подсветка ГС-3 для унипанелей.

 

1286055825_2.thumb.jpg.69f22bd4ae85f574efa34354484d4e5a.jpg

 

назначена в роутере произвольная переменная на тумблер (1 при замыкании, 0 при размыкании) и эта же переменная на светодиод.

а чтобы тумблер в игре включал подсветку, через вирт джой и настройки управления, ставим этот тумблер.

Posted
надо будет для удобства подключения делать на корпусе еще одну отдельную розетку питания, чтобы последовательно подключать устройства и не делать разветвление проводов на блоке питания.

Да, тоже такая мысль пришла в голову пока подключал. И может даже другой тип разъема под это использовать.

НЕТ ВОБЛЕ!

Posted

Еще один способ синхронизировать тумблеры:

 

1) ставим галочку в настройках игры /вкладка "Разные" / пункт " синхронизировать переключатели кабины

 

2) в конфигураторе тумблеры сделать тумблерами (в одном положении вирт кнопка постоянно нажата, во втором постоянно отжата)

 

3) включаем их в вирт. джойстике

 

4) в настройках управления игры привязываем как обычно

 

Это позволяет синхронизировать двухпозиционные тумблеры на которых в игре не предусмотрено раздельное управление (когда они переключаются в любое положение одной кнопкой)

 

и для этого не требуется даже пользоваться кнопкой опроса импульсных значений.

но в каждой бочке есть ложка дегтя, так как таким образом нельзя синхронизировать трехпозиционные тумблеры , да и все прочие многопозиционне, и галетники тоже, для них подходит только раздельное управление.

Posted

Смотрю на фото готовых девайсов и поражаюсь. Великолепное исполнение! :thumbup:

 

Глядя на эти работы, а еще на проекты Баура и многих других, понимашешь, что рано или поздно очередной "кокпитостроитель" в припадке вдохновения случайно соберет настоящий самолет. :)

 

 

  • Gigabyte Z97X SLI
  • i5 4670K OC + СoolerMaster 212 Evo
  • inno3D GTX980 iChill
  • 16 GB RAM
  • OCZ Vector 128 GB SSD + 3TB Seagate HDD
  • M-Audio 2496 Audiophile
  • Pimax 4K HMD

 

  • Self-made air mouse controller
  • VKB Cobra Z (BRD Mod)
  • Gametrix ECS; VKB T-Rudder
  • Custom Mjoy 16 switch panel
  • Wireless Inertial Tracker + Opentrack

 

 

 

Posted (edited)
Смотрю на фото готовых девайсов и поражаюсь. Великолепное исполнение! :thumbup:

 

Глядя на эти работы, а еще на проекты Баура и многих других, понимашешь, что рано или поздно очередной "кокпитостроитель" в припадке вдохновения случайно соберет настоящий самолет. :)

 

Не дай Бог..., разобьется еще:P,

лучше пусть будет летягой, зверем летающим, но все таки, не по настоящему!;)

Edited by Alextus
Posted (edited)

Появилось время заняться уни панелями! Пока не придумал как их расположить, стоят на "воздухе". Изделия сделано замечательно глаза радуют, есть мелкие недочеты в ПО. В общем я доволен!

Надо будет сделать надписи для САС. и настроить все кнопки и переключатели

Заметил что при использовании экспорта у меня fps с 60 упал до 30 с этим будем дальше разбираться!

Еще не разобрался как сделать мигающее табло?

DSC_0093.thumb.JPG.fd03d3d0ff49157f513bd2b1943ac852.JPG

1234.jpg.5a3bcb4404425eca73c6ef2e5a396be8.jpg

Edited by =СВГ=Sanek

Комп: MSI GTX 1080ti GAMING X, MSI Z370 GAMING M5, Intel Core i7-8700K Coffee Lake, Kingston DDR4 32Gb, SSD M2 Samsung 970PRO, Gunfighter Pro MCG Pro, BRD-F2 Restyling, Trackir5 + clip pro:smilewink:

Posted (edited)
Появилось время заняться уни панелями! Пока не придумал как их расположить...

 

Можно прикрепить к плоскости какой нибудь за винты с обратной стороны.

расположение винтов квадратного модуля такое, у прямоугольного то же, но средние винты в другом месте

238683241_.jpg.361e5a88cb2c70323e06049f01140e71.jpg

 

Заметил что при использовании экспорта у меня fps с 60 упал до 30 с этим будем дальше разбираться!

Еще не разобрался как сделать мигающее табло?

 

Светодиод вроде верно настроен, с этим надо у Станислава уточнить.

Кстати, он написал подробнейшее руководство к контроллеру

Edited by Alextus
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...